2025 Alfa Romeo Tonale vs 2026 Buick Envision
Comparison Overview
The 2025 Alfa Romeo Tonale offers Italian passion wrapped in a compact, stylish package starting at an enticing $36,495. Drivers seeking immediate engagement will gravitate toward its badge, even if raw power numbers are omitted from the provided specs for comparison against the Buick. Conversely, the 2026 Buick Envision arrives with a clear performance metric: a solid 228 hp and 258 lb-ft of torque, positioning it as the more muscular choice, despite sharing an identical 24 combined MPG rating with the Alfa. The Buick demands a higher entry price of $41,000, creating a $4,505 gap against the Tonale. Furthermore, the Envision offers slightly more utility with a 25.2 cu ft cargo capacity versus the Tonale's 22.9 cu ft. Both utilize an AWD setup paired with a 9-speed shiftable automatic, but the Alfa's diminutive 178.3-inch length hints at sharper urban agility compared to the longer Buick.

Frequently Asked Questions
Common questions about comparing the 2025 Alfa Romeo Tonale and 2026 Buick Envision.
How does the required premium fuel for the Alfa Romeo Tonale affect long-term running costs compared to the Envision?
The Alfa Romeo Tonale mandates premium unleaded, which typically costs more per gallon than regular fuel. Although both crossovers share a 24 combined MPG rating, the Tonale’s fuel requirement will likely result in higher overall expenditure at the pump over time.
What is the significance of the 228 hp rating in the 2026 Buick Envision for real-world driving?
The 228 hp output provides the Envision with a measurable edge in acceleration and passing power, especially important for merging onto highways. This concrete power figure stands in contrast to the Tonale, whose horsepower is not specified in the current comparison data.
Is the physical size difference between these two AWD crossovers noticeable?
Yes, the 2026 Buick Envision is significantly larger, measuring 182.7 inches long compared to the Tonale's 178.3 inches. This extra 4.4 inches in length translates directly to the Envision's larger cargo capacity.

Do the highway MPG ratings show a major difference between these two AWD crossovers?
The difference in highway efficiency is minimal; the Tonale achieves 29 MPG highway while the Envision is rated at 28 MPG highway. Both demonstrate commendable efficiency for all-wheel-drive vehicles.
